Trang 12― The climate of Scotland
is temperate and oceanic, and tends to be very changeable
― It is warmed by the Gulf Stream from
the Atlantic, it has much milder winters (but cooler, wetter summers) than areas on similar latitudes. The west of Scotland is usually
warmer than the east.
― Mountainous areas with 3 parts: the
highlands, the lowlands, and the Islands. The highest mountains : Ben Nevis, 1342 m
― Have lakes (called “lochs”), forests, hundreds
of km of seashore
